What this means

Status 710 means the registration was cancelled because a required Section 8 declaration of continued use was not filed within the deadline (including any grace period). The federal registration is no longer active. Evaluate filing a new application if you still use the mark, or petition if cancellation was erroneous. Consult counsel on remaining common-law rights.

Aug 15, 1995NOAMNOA MAILED - SOU REQUIRED FROM APPLICANTA Notice of Allowance means your intent-to-use application cleared examination and opposition but is not registered yet. You must file a Statement of Use showing the mark in commerce, or request an extension, before the deadline — usually six months from the notice date.
May 23, 1995PUBOPUBLISHED FOR OPPOSITIONYour mark was published in the USPTO Official Gazette for a 30-day opposition window. During that period, third parties who believe they would be harmed can file an opposition. If no opposition is filed, prosecution usually continues toward registration or a Notice of Allowance.
